KOTA KINABALU: The Sabah police have arrested 18 people after tailing a passenger-laden four-wheel drive vehicle near Tawau on Tuesday (Nov 16) night.
Tawau Marine police operations commanding officer Deputy Supt Ridzauddin Selamat said that 17 of those arrested were undocumented migrants aged between six-months-old and 50-years-old.
He added that it is believed that the 17 had just arrived from Indonesia on a boat.
“They were fetched by a driver upon arrival,” he said in a statement on Wednesday (Nov 17).
He said the 31-year-old driver was asked to pull over at about 8.30pm when they reached a traffic light intersection, and added that all 17 immigrants were found cramped inside.
It is unclear where they were headed to but it is believed they were on their way to a workers quarters.
DSP Ridzauddin said all the suspects were brought to the Tawau marine base for investigations.
The vehicle used was also seized following the arrest.
“We are investigating this case under the Trafficking in Persons and the Smuggling of Migrants Act (ATIPSOM) 2007,” he said.
